Scan barcode
232 pages • missing pub info (editions)
ISBN/UID: 9781138161436
Format: Hardcover
Language: English
Publisher: Routledge Cavendish
Publication date: 27 January 2017
232 pages • missing pub info (editions)
ISBN/UID: 9781138161436
Format: Hardcover
Language: English
Publisher: Routledge Cavendish
Publication date: 27 January 2017
232 pages • missing pub info (editions)
ISBN/UID: 9781904385301
Format: Paperback
Language: English
Publisher: Routledge Cavendish
Publication date: 06 April 2005
232 pages • missing pub info (editions)
ISBN/UID: 9781904385301
Format: Paperback
Language: English
Publisher: Routledge Cavendish
Publication date: 06 April 2005